According to the public record, Flat 11, 28, Hyde Park Gardens, London is a period apartment with 925 ft2 of internal area.
Apartments of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ms.
The apartment is in 28, Hyde Park Gardens, London, W2.
Hyde Park Gardens, London, W2 is located in the borough of City of Westminster within the W2 postal district.
Flat 11, 28, Hyde Park Gardens, London has no recent1 records in the Land Registry database and a single entry in the EPC database dated April 2017.

According to HM Land Registry, Flat 11, 28, Hyde Park Gardens, London was last sold on 23 Dec 1999 for £345,000 and was recorded as a leasehold flat.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
According to the Land Registry and our network of Estate Agents, there have been 3 sales of properties similar to Flat 11, 28, Hyde Park Gardens, London within a radius of 340 metres over the last 2 years.
The most recent example is Flat 8, 31, Hyde Park Gardens, London, W2 2ND, a Leasehold flat which sold for £1,835,000 in Jan 2022.

Flat 11, 28, Hyde Park Gardens, London has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 18 Apr 2017.
The property is connected to mains gas and has some double glazing. It is heated using a community scheme.
The closest station to Flat 11, 28, Hyde Park Gardens, London is Lancaster Gate station which is 200 metres away.
According to data from the Environment Agency, the flood risk in this area is considered to be very low.
